Understanding Portable Quiet Generators
Portable quiet generators are compact, mobile devices designed to provide temporary electrical power with minimal noise output. Unlike traditional generators, these units are engineered with soundproof enclosures, advanced muffler systems, and inverter technology to reduce operational noise, making them suitable for residential neighborhoods, campgrounds, and sensitive environments. They typically operate on fuels such as gasoline, diesel, or propane and can power essential appliances, tools, and electronic devices during outages or in off-grid locations. With added features like automatic voltage regulation, fuel efficiency monitoring, and parallel connectivity, portable quiet generators ensure consistent and stable power supply for a variety of applications.

Technological Advancements and Innovations
Innovation is a significant factor shaping the portable quiet generator market. Modern units integrate inverter technology, which converts raw power into stable, usable electricity suitable for sensitive electronics like laptops, smartphones, and medical devices. Noise reduction techniques, including improved mufflers, vibration dampeners, and sound-insulated casings, allow generators to operate at sound levels as low as 50–60 decibels, comparable to normal conversation. Smart monitoring features, remote control operation, and fuel efficiency sensors enhance user convenience and operational efficiency. Manufacturers are also exploring hybrid models that combine solar or battery backup systems with traditional fuel sources, catering to environmentally conscious consumers and off-grid applications.

Challenges Facing the Market
Despite promising growth, the portable quiet generator market faces certain challenges. The high upfront cost of advanced inverter models may limit adoption among price-sensitive consumers. Dependence on fossil fuels raises concerns regarding emissions and environmental impact, prompting the need for alternative energy solutions. Additionally, maintenance requirements, including fuel storage, regular servicing, and safe operation, can influence consumer purchasing decisions. Competition from emerging battery-based and solar-powered portable power solutions also poses a challenge, as these alternatives offer quieter operation, reduced emissions, and lower maintenance requirements. Addressing these challenges requires manufacturers to balance performance, affordability, and eco-friendliness in product design.
